Interview question
What is the difference between Comparable and Comparator in Java? Java में Comparable और Comparator में क्या अंतर है?
Answer
| Aspect | Comparable | Comparator |
|---|---|---|
| Package | java.lang | java.util |
| Method | compareTo(Object o) | compare(Object o1, Object o2) |
| Sorting logic location | Inside the class being sorted | Separate class or lambda |
| Number of orderings | Only ONE natural ordering per class | MULTIPLE different orderings possible |
// Comparable - defines natural ordering INSIDE the class
class Employee implements Comparable<Employee> {
String name;
int age;
Employee(String name, int age) { this.name = name; this.age = age; }
@Override
public int compareTo(Employee other) {
return this.age - other.age; // natural order = by age
}
}
List<Employee> employees = new ArrayList<>();
employees.add(new Employee('John', 30));
employees.add(new Employee('Jane', 25));
Collections.sort(employees); // uses compareTo() - sorted by age
// Comparator - defines ordering OUTSIDE the class, multiple possible
Comparator<Employee> byName = (e1, e2) -> e1.name.compareTo(e2.name);
Comparator<Employee> byAgeDesc = (e1, e2) -> e2.age - e1.age;
employees.sort(byName); // sort by name
employees.sort(byAgeDesc); // sort by age, descending
// Chaining comparators (Java 8+)
Comparator<Employee> byNameThenAge = Comparator
.comparing((Employee e) -> e.name)
